Why These Are the Top GMC Repair Auto Repair Shops in Newcastle

The GMC repair market servicing Newcastle, ME, is characterized by a small number of highly capable, independent repair shops located in neighboring towns. Due to the rural nature of the region, there are no dedicated GMC-only specialists; instead, expertise is found within broader "domestic" or "truck and SUV" focused garages. The level of competition is moderate, with a handful of reputable shops dominating the market for complex repairs. Customers highly value trustworthiness and long-term reputation over brand-specific marketing. Pricing is generally in line with regional averages, with labor rates typically ranging from $110-$150 per hour. For highly specialized diesel or transmission work, some residents may travel to larger centers like Brunswick or Augusta, but the providers listed above are capable of handling the vast majority of service needs for GMC owners in the local area.

What are the most common GMC repair issues for vehicles in the Newcastle, Maine area?

Given our coastal climate and rural roads, common issues for local GMC trucks and SUVs include rust prevention and undercarriage damage from winter road salt, as well as suspension and alignment wear from uneven country roads. Diesel-specific problems in models like the Sierra 2500/3500 are also frequent due to their popularity for local trades and hauling.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y GMC repair shop in Newcastle?

Look for a shop with certified technicians who have specific experience with GMC models, particularly trucks and SUVs. In a small community like Newcastle, personal recommendations from neighbors and checking online reviews for local shops are invaluable for assessing honesty and quality of work.

When should I seek local service for my GMC's check engine light instead of driving to a distant dealer?

You should seek immediate local diagnostics in Newcastle if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ire, or if accompanied by noticeable performance loss, overheating, or strange noises. For a steady light, a local shop can quickly read the code to determine if it's a minor issue or requires specialist attention, saving you a long drive to a dealer.

Are repair costs for GMC vehicles higher in Newcastle comp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in Newcastle may be slightly lower than in metropolitan areas, but parts costs are generally consistent. The primary local consideration is that specialized repairs for complex drivetrains (like Duramax diesel) might require sourcing specific parts, potentially adding a short wait time compared to a major dealer's inventory.

What local seasonal service should Newcastle GMC owners prioritize?

Before winter, a thorough undercarriage inspection for rust and a check of the 4WD system, battery, and tires are critical due to Maine's harsh winters. In spring, a follow-up undercarriage wash to remove salt and a suspension check for pothole damage from frost-heaved roads are highly recommended to prevent long-term issues.
